PopskyTestFlight
Poster

Tagulilong

2023 • Directed by

Ivan Zaldarriaga

Mystery, Drama

Four hikers were last seen planning to go on a mountain excursion. All they left behind on the trail was a camera. The footage in it revealed what happened to them.

Release Date

9/14/2023

Rating

0.0/10